South Korea's Gwangju Accelerates Military Airport Relocation for Semiconductor Megaproject, Aims for Production by 2030

Deep News
Jul 12

South Korean officials stated on Sunday that the relocation of a military airport in the southwestern city of Gwangju is being expedited, as the original site has been designated for the development of a major semiconductor industry cluster.

The allocation of the former Gwangju military airport site for this industrial cluster is part of the South Korean government's "three major key projects." These initiatives are focused on the large-scale regional deployment of semiconductor manufacturing, physical artificial intelligence, and AI data center industries.

A special committee comprising central and local government officials is scheduled to convene later this month to finalize potential new locations for the relocated airport. Muan County was listed as a preliminary candidate site in April.

The local government overseeing Gwangju anticipates that the new airport site will be finalized by the end of this year. The plan is to advance both the airport relocation and the industrial cluster construction simultaneously, with the goal of commencing semiconductor production by 2030.
